Florence Knoll 1961 - With her typical modesty, Florence Knoll described her own line of desks as the “meat and potatoes” which had to be provided. “I did it because I needed the piece of furniture for a job and it wasn’t there, so I designed it.” While this may have been the motivation for the 1961 Table Desk, the result is anything but a fill-in piece. Perfectly proportioned and flawlessly detailed, the design embodies Florence Knoll’s adherence to the teachings of her favourite mentor, Mies van der Rohe.
Construction & Details:
- Tabletops available in laminate, wood, coated and natural marble, and natural granite in a wide range of colours and finishes
- Wood, coated and natural marble, and laminate tabletops are attached to a sub-top for added support
- Frame and legs are heavy gauges welded steel with polished or satin chrome finish
- KnollStudio logo and Florence Knoll’s signature are stamped into the base of the table
